Barnes & Noble New Store Experience Case Study:
Retail Fixture Program & Nationwide Rollout

Overview
Barnes & Noble partnered with VCI/Rose to reinvent the modern bookstore through a scalable, value-engineered retail fixture program. The goal was to create a warmer, discovery-driven environment that increases dwell time while supporting an efficient rollout across hundreds of locations nationwide.

The Challenge
Barnes & Noble sought to move away from traditional, library-style layouts and introduce a more engaging, boutique-inspired store experience. The new store fixture program needed to:

Increase product visibility with face-out book displays
Support cross-merchandising of books, gifts, and games
Allow localized customization
Remain cost-efficient and scalable
Balancing design innovation with a repeatable, national retail fixture system was critical to long-term success.

The Solution
VCI/Rose developed a flexible, scalable retail fixture system designed to support storytelling, merchandising versatility, and operational efficiency.

Prominent merchandising tables highlight new releases and curated assortments, while integrated displays encourage cross-category shopping. The custom retail fixture program was engineered to support books, toys, journals, and seasonal items using adaptable core components. This approach allows stores to refresh layouts without replacing hardware, extending the lifecycle of the fixture investment.

Long aisles were replaced with themed nooks and intuitive adjacencies, creating a more immersive shopping experience. Updated finishes, clean lines, and a modernized cash wrap complete the refreshed environment, reinforcing Barnes & Noble’s evolution while maintaining brand heritage.

Execution
Through strategic value engineering and standardized components, VCI/Rose ensured the retail fixture program could scale efficiently. Fixtures were engineered for repeatable manufacturing, simplified installation, and consistent quality across locations.

VCI/Rose managed manufacturing, warehousing, and the coordinated nationwide rollout of the fixture program, delivering thousands of fixtures across new and remodeled stores.

The Result
The new Barnes & Noble store concept demonstrates how a thoughtfully designed retail fixture program can transform the in-store experience. Customers are encouraged to explore and discover, while store teams maintain merchandising flexibility within a cohesive national brand framework.

The scalable fixture program positions Barnes & Noble for continued growth while maximizing long-term operational efficiency.
